  12. I have heard rumors about this at the start of Baselworld 2008. What makes it worst is ETA competitors such as Sellita also has trouble keeping up with demands. I have to agree it should be slowing down now due to global financial crisis but I have yet to see much of high end watch sales got affected (perhaps not so soon)... What make it worst is, they are aware of high end reps utilizing genuine ETA movement too.... So, probably more background check on potential customers. ETA may not even sell those Top grade movement for watchmaker/independent watchmaker outside Switzerland (legit or otherwise). Solution: stick to Asian movement

  14. Most handwound comes with 1.2mm. Most if not all reps with Asian 7750 comes with 0.9 stem but you can interchange it with genuine ETA stem for 7750 which comes with 2 sizes (i think same case as 6497 series too).
